TL;DR Summary

After a warm afternoon, temperatures have dropped into the 30s and 40s in Boston, accompanied by a strong breeze. Highs today will be in the mid to upper 40s, below average for this time of year. Tonight, light sleet and rain are expected, mainly in northern MA/NH/VT. Road impacts are expected to be limited, but some slick spots may occur in higher terrain areas. By midday tomorrow, the area will experience rain showers, which will taper off in the evening. The chillier air will persist through the weekend, with temperatures in the 40s to low 50s.
